Evans, Scott A.
Scott A. Evans, 50, of Iowa City, died Saturday, Sept. 5, 2009, at his residence following a short illness. A gathering time for family and friends to share Scott's life will be held from 4 to 8 p.m. Wednesday at at Gay & Ciha Funeral and Cremation Service.
In lieu of flowers, a memorial fund has been established in his memory.

Scott Allen Evans was born Oct. 3, 1958, in Iowa City, the son of Stanley “Sonny” and Shirley (Blaha) Evans. For over 20 years Scott had worked for Goodwill Industries of Eastern Iowa. For the past 10 years he had been with the Reach for Your Potential organization here in Iowa City. Scott enjoyed life, drinking his Pepsi, writing endlessly, taking drives to the country, listening and showing others how to dance to Elvis, and being with his family and friends!
His family includes two brothers and their wives, Stanley “Jody” Evans (Cathy) of Tipton and Sheldon Evans (Dianna) of North Liberty; stepbrothers and stepsisters, Doug Evans (Mary) of Iowa City, Candy Hawkins (Gene) of Marengo, Chad Evans of Windham, Tracy Evans (Lori) of Windham, Blaine Evans of Windham and Bart Evans (Karen) of Windham; and numerous nieces and nephews.
Scott was preceded in death by his parents; stepfather, Dean Evans; infant brother, Sharm Evans; stepsister, Becky Evans; and stepbrothers, Marc and Neal Evans.
Gay & Ciha Funeral and Cremation Service is caring for Scott's family and his services.
